Stolen limo found at the bottom of a lake in Canada

limo-bus-lake

A 20-seater limousine bus costing $100,000 has been found at the bottom of a lake in Canada. Police believe the vehicle may have been driven off the cliff and into the water below deliberately.

The giant limo was stolen in the early hours of Sunday morning from Sun Valley Limousine. The vehicle was first spotted submerged in the water in the Okangan Lake shortly after 9:30am on Sunday morning.

The police searched the shoreline around the lake to search for signs of any victims who may have been travelling onboard the limo bus, but are yet to find any indications of passengers. A dive team has been scheduled to search the water where the limo was found to check for any passengers who may have been trapped onboard the vehicle.

However the authorities believe that the signs show the limo was driven off the cliff top, plummeting 100 feet into the lake below on purpose. There is no indication the limo rolled off the cliff as it appears it was driven off the road at a straight angle, as opposed to following the curve of the road.

Before coming to its watery end, the luxury 20-seater limousine bus was hired out for celebrations and events and was especially popular with party-goers attending school proms, hen and stag parties and birthday celebrations.

Drunk man wakes up in limo and drives it home

SANYO DIGITAL CAMERA

A reveller in Nebraska who had been travelling on a 40ft limo bus as part of a group of friends is now facing criminal charges as its alleged he woke up in the limo and proceeded to drive the vehicle to his home last weekend.

30-year-old Steven Hunter was caught after his wallet was found onboard the limo after the giant party bus was found parked up a few streets from his home in the Mid West of America.

Police believe the man had passed out in the toilet area of the 40ft long limousine after having a few too many. At 3:30am the chauffeur parked the limo back at the limo hire company’s depot, leaving the keys inside the vehicle.

When the limo company boss arrived at the depot the following morning and found the $80,000 limo bus missing, he raised the alarm with the police.

It is thought that the party goer woke up inside the limo and discovered the keys, at which point he proceeded to drive the limo to his home. However when questioned by police, Steven Hunter denies this, saying he has no recollection of the incidents which lead to the limo being found abandoned in a street near to his house.

The man has since been charged with criminal mischief and unauthorised use of a vehicle.

Over 400 pupils attend school prom fair in Stafford

school-prom

A school prom fair held in Stafford last week was deemed a roaring success after 400 youngsters from across the area turned out for the event which showcased the best prom suppliers in the Staffordshire region.

The school prom fair was held at Wolstanton High School and was organised by pupils mainly from Milehouse Lane School. 30 prefects and school students worked together with a handful of teachers to plan the prom fair event.

Prom suppliers from across Staffordshire and further afield turned out to showcase their services at the event. A Catwalk show featuring the latest prom dresses and formal menswear was one of the main attractions and proved very popular with the teens.

Limo hire for school proms is big business with many operators booking out many months in advance for peak prom dates. A party bus provider attended the prom fair last week to show off the converted bus which offers superb transport for prom goers.

The party bus owner said his vehicle is extremely sought after for school proms as it has a number of fantastic entertainment features including an onboard dance floor, which is perfect for a celebration such as a prom.

2 teenage revellers in Canadian party bus fall

Limo-Bus

Party buses are very popular with youngsters travelling to school proms

A celebration for a 17th birthday onboard a party bus ended disaster after two teenage girls fell out of the side of bus as it took a bend in the road.

The party bus was travelling in Langley, Canada last Friday evening when the incident took place. Police witnessed the teenagers tumble from the party bus while it was moving. The emergency services were called and one of the girls was taken to hospital having sustained head injuries. She was released later that night after receiving medical treatment. The other girl escaped from the accident unscathed.

Party buses are a very popular form of transport both in Canada and the UK for celebrating special occasions. One of reasons they are favoured by youngsters for birthday parties or school proms is that they offer room for more passengers than the average limousines, plus many party buses have onboard dance floors and karaoke machines which are an added attraction. Following the accident in Canada, the party was brought to an abrupt end after police boarded the party bus and questioned a number of witnesses including the chaperon and the driver. Witnesses reported that someone onboard the vehicle had pushed the emergency exit open as the party bus turned the corner.

The company which supplied the party bus says they are looking into the possibility of having an alarm installed which sounds if the emergency exit is opened to avoid a similar situation arising.

Limo Hire Company boss loses licence appeal

Limousine company owner loses out at licence appeal hearing

A Lanarkshire-based limo hire company boss has lost her appeal to have her business licence reinstated.

1st Class Limos had its licence removed by the Transport Commissioner for Scotland after the firm was discovered to have been operating while in breach of a number regulations. An independent transport tribunal held recently sided with the Traffic Commissioner and upheld its previous ruling to strip the company of its licence.

The business ran into difficulties after it emerged that the owner had been operating for some years without a valid licence. The limousine hire firm was also found to have been providing alcohol packages for customers travelling in its vehicles without a valid liquor licence.

However the owner of 1st Class Limos, Lisa Raffety, argues that she has been made a “scapegoat” following new regulations which were introduced which made it difficult for limo bosses to operate within the rules. Ms Raffety added that until recently, it was “impossible to meet the requirements of the licence because the necessary adjustments could not be made to the vehicles.”

The former limo boss upholds that she wasn’t doing anything different to many other party limo companies, adding that these firms are now starting up new businesses under different names “so that they can’t be judged on their trading history.” The decision to remove her license has had a bad affect on the businesswoman as she revealed that she’s had to sell a number of her limousines.
